Output 588098e59cf4101ef15ab4979d11d013215e5f36211dca8a1cbdd07fc23ab1f2:0

value
559734
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3c0fc48853cc3e442c5e755d99599a20989b207a OP_EQUAL
address
37AbMcWC1DY25GHTsmTvNo2WqBnkVywr4S
transaction
588098e59cf4101ef15ab4979d11d013215e5f36211dca8a1cbdd07fc23ab1f2
spent
true